I was thinking that it was the other way around, anything using Hynix BFR or CFR H9C ( H5TQ2G83BFR and H5TQ2G83CFR, respectively) will always be double-sided, it is the Samsung based stuff that could be either double-sided HCH9 (K4B2G0846D), or single-sided something else (Don_Dan suggested perhaps K4B4G0846B in his post #129 in this thread http://www.xtremesystems.org/forums/...-Preview/page6).
I was thinking that 8GB Hynix is double sided (16x512) and 4GB is just single sided (8x512) but i have never owned Hynix so i'm not 100% sure. I thought Hynix chips only came in 512MB flavour? I know Samsung makes 256MB HCH9 chips so 4GB sticks should be double sided then.
Both Hynix and Samsung have 2Gb and 4Gb ICs that could be used in these kits:
2Gb ICs ( 2GB single sided/ 4GB double sided sticks ):
- Samsung K4B2G0846D-(HCH9/HYK0/etc)
- Hynix H5TQ2G83(BFR/CFR)-(H9C/PBC)
4Gb ICs ( 4GB single sided/ 8GB double sided sticks ):
- Samsung K4B4G0846B-(HCH9/MCH9/MCF7/etc)
- Hynix H5TQ4G83MFR-(H9C/PBC)

In his review of the 2x4GB GEIL EVO Veloce DDR3-2133, posted on Overclockers, Woomack reached 1400MHz C11 on these CFR based modules, however, voltage was much higher at 1.775v. He also hit 1300MHz CL11 @ 1.65v. I was personally surprised and impressed by those results on CFR (H5TQ2G83CFR). I'm pretty sure that's the best results for CFR that I've seen.
